A Comprehensive Guide to Soffit Board Repair
Soffit boards are an essential yet typically neglected component of your home's exterior. They cover the underside of eaves, providing ventilation and defense from the aspects. However, like any part of a structure, they can struggle with damage over time due to rot, pests, or severe weather. Understanding Soffit Board Damage
The primary step to repairing soffit boards is acknowledging the signs of damage. Typical signs include:
Visible Rot: Dark, mushy areas on the soffit show moisture damage.Spaces and Cracks: Cracks or spaces might allow bugs to enter your home or increase the threat of water damage.Peeling Paint: Paint that is flaking or bubbling recommends moisture is trapped below.Bug Infestation: Sightings of insects or nests within or around the soffit can recommend a point of entry or damage.Damage Causes and Prevention
Numerous elements can cause soffit board damage:

To prevent damage, ensure proper ventilation is installed, frequently examine your roofing system and eaves, and preserve a dry environment in your attic.
Repairing Soffit Boards
Repairing soffit boards usually includes 3 actions: examining the damage, carrying out the repair, and preventing future issues. Here is a detailed guide to each phase:
Step 1: Assessing the Damage
To commence the repair procedure, property owners must:
Conduct a Visual Inspection: Look for signs of damage or insect activity.Inspect for Moisture: Use moisture meters to discover wetness in the soffit.Test Structural Integrity: Gently poke the wood with a screwdriver or similar tool. Gather Materials: You will need replacement soffit boards, nails or screws, a lever, and a saw.
ProductPurposeSoffit BoardsTo replace broken sectionsNails/ScrewsTo secure the brand-new boardsLeverTo eliminate old boardsSawTo cut boards to size
Remove Damaged Sections: Use a crowbar to carefully detach the damaged soffit board from the structure.
Cut New Boards: Measure and cut the replacement boards to fit comfortably in the area.
Set Up New Boards: Secure them into location with screws or nails, guaranteeing they are flush with the surrounding structure.
Seal Joints: Use caulking to seal any joints or gaps to avoid future moisture infiltration.

Search for signs of rot, noticeable gaps, peeling paint, or signs of bugs. A basic assessment every six months can help catch problems early.
2. Can I repair soffit boards myself?
Yes, minor repairs can often be dealt with by a DIY enthusiast. However, for extensive damage, hiring a professional might be recommended to make sure appropriate methods and longevity.
3. For how long does a repair take?
Minor repairs can take a few hours, while complete replacements may take a weekend depending upon the size of the task and ability level.
4. What products are suggested for soffit boards?
Common materials consist of vinyl, aluminum, and wood. Vinyl is extremely advised due to its durability and low maintenance.
5. Should I paint brand-new soffit boards?
If you pick wood or a material that requires painting, guarantee you utilize weather-resistant paint to extend the lifespan of your repair.
